Eclectic, experimental, and hard hitting are just few words to describe the artist Digibilly (Joshua Pearson). He’s a Drum & Bass / EDM producer out of Philadelphia, PA. His music encapsulates the root essence of Drum & Bass while bringing a new twist to the genre by including Metal, Hip-Hop, and the modern-day sounds of EDM in each composition. Digibilly’s music is driven by his eclectic love of many genres. He sees Drum & Bass as a versatile canvas that is waiting to be painted and manipulated. Overall, his music has a tendency to be dark and heavy, but all of it has a momentum that will move your feet. The fusion of sounds and beats from different genres is what makes what he is. This fusion of the new with the old is the true definition of the word, “Digibilly”.
Driven by production quality and sound engineering, he finds beauty in complex simplicity. In doing this, he follows a similar technique to his inspirations. Noisia, one of his main inspirations, has been very influencial in the sound that he creates. He also loves the energy and alternative sounds of bands like Prodigy, Fear Factory, and KMFDM. You can hear this inspiration in a lot of his heavier tracks. But on the other side of things, he has admiration and finds inspiration in some turntablists such as DJ Shadow, Qbert, and R2D2.
His debut Album, “Audible Manipulations of a Digital Frontier”, is a true example of Digibilly’s diversity. It’s a spectrum of sounds and sub-genres. A popular track on the album is “Run To Me”, which is a collaboration with the singer/songwriter Andrea Stankevitch of the group Brite Lite Brite. They have plans in works for them to do more projects together in the near future. Another interesting track on the album is ”Apocalypse”, a hard hitting track that shows his metal and industrial influences of the past.
The next album, “(sin)tax”, will be a lot heavier and have a powerful fusion of Metal and Drum & Bass. His latest released, “The Alexus Nexus”, which is a benefit song to help with a little girl’s fight with HLH. It is a lot softer then the typical Digibilly sound. It’s lyrics are motivational and all proceeds go to Alexus’s family. He also is working on a single with the singer/songwriter, Carolyn Thorn. The song is called “Joker”. It is about the infamous Batman Character and has a crowd moving EDM sound.
